Bug Description
See attachment.
The Zenith image is upside down, which makes it incredible hard to set control points manually.
It would be nice if the Zenith image would automatically rotate in relation to the image from the "4 around images" one tries to set CPs to.
Or have at least a field and button to rotate it manually by x degrees.

Do I understand correctly that the pop-up window in front of Hugin is how you would like to have the image orientated?
Hugin currently does orientate images automatically in relationship to the panosphere, and in the case of a Zenith + 4 around as shown in the screenshot it gets the orientation "right" in only one out of four cases.
It would definitely help if the user could rotate the image in the CP tab manually. I would say that 90° rotations suffice. Also it would help to have a toggle to enable/disable the auto-orientation.
